Broncos sign linebacker Brandon Marshall to a four-year extension
Denver Broncos inside linebacker Brandon Marshall has signed a four-year, $32 million extension through 2020.
The deal includes $20 million in guarantees, including a $10 million signing bonus, per NFL.com's Ian Rapoport. Marshall was a restricted free agent who had yet to sign his tender.
A former fifth-round pick, Marshall has become a force for Denver, which finished last season ranked first in Adjusted Defensive Net Expected Points per play. Playing in all 16 games in 2015, Marshall totaled 100-plus tackles for the the second straight season.
